JMS567固件性能测试揭秘:基准测试与实战应用解析

发布时间: 2025-08-01 11:02:01 阅读量: 2 订阅数: 5
RAR

JMS567 固件 usb3.0 tosata3.0

star5星 · 资源好评率100%
![JMS567固件性能测试揭秘:基准测试与实战应用解析](https://i1.ruliweb.com/img/23/09/08/18a733bea4f4bb4d4.png) # 摘要 本文系统地介绍了JMS567固件性能测试的理论基础和实践操作。首先,对基准测试进行了概述,强调了其在固件评估中的重要性,并详细讨论了性能指标分析及测试流程。随后,文章深入探讨了JMS567固件的基准测试实践,包括测试环境搭建、多款基准测试工具的应用以及测试结果的详细解读。此外,还分析了JMS567固件在服务器和企业级应用中的实战案例,讨论了其在负载均衡、高可用集群搭建和虚拟化环境下的性能表现。最后,文章提出了针对JMS567固件性能优化的策略,并对其未来应用前景进行了展望,强调了它对企业IT基础设施可能带来的影响。 # 关键字 固件性能测试;基准测试;性能指标;测试工具;稳定性测试;IT基础设施 参考资源链接:[JMS567固件更新:USB3.0转SATA3.0固态硬盘兼容性提升](https://wenku.csdn.net/doc/83s9aoz5tn?spm=1055.2635.3001.10343) # 1. JMS567固件性能测试概述 随着IT技术的飞速发展,固件更新换代的速度也越来越快。本文将带你探索JMS567固件的性能测试流程,旨在为企业用户提供一个全面的性能分析和应用指导。 ## 1.1 固件性能测试的重要性 在选择固件时,性能测试是关键步骤。通过性能测试可以确保固件的稳定性和可靠性,以适应企业用户对于高性能计算的不断增长的需求。 ## 1.2 固件性能测试的目标 固件性能测试通常涉及到多个层面,包括但不限于系统响应时间、并发处理能力、数据吞吐量以及资源利用效率等。这些目标决定了测试的方向和侧重点。 在下一章,我们将深入了解基准测试的理论基础,进一步探究如何有效地进行固件性能测试。 # 2. 基准测试的理论基础 在IT领域,基准测试是衡量和比较系统性能的关键工具。它允许我们收集有关硬件和软件性能的客观数据,以便进行比较、优化和调整。本章深入探讨基准测试的基础知识,为理解JMS567固件性能测试打下坚实的基础。 ### 2.1 基准测试的定义与目的 #### 2.1.1 理解基准测试的重要性 基准测试是在受控环境中对系统执行的一系列标准化测试程序。这些测试旨在模拟现实世界的使用情景,以评估系统在特定工作负载下的性能。它是至关重要的,因为基准测试数据提供了一个量化的性能指标,这些指标可以用于: - 系统比较:比较不同硬件和软件配置下的性能。 - 性能监控:检测系统性能随时间的变化。 - 调优与优化:识别系统瓶颈并进行针对性的调优。 - 规划未来需求:为未来的系统升级和采购提供数据支持。 #### 2.1.2 选择合适的基准测试工具 选择合适的基准测试工具是进行有效测试的第一步。不同的测试工具有不同的特点和优势,可以根据测试目标和环境来选择: - 对于CPU性能,像Linpack这样的工具可以模拟数值计算负载。 - 对于I/O性能,Iometer可以模拟现实世界中I/O操作的模式。 - 网络性能测试可以使用iperf这样的工具来衡量带宽和延迟。 ### 2.2 常见的性能指标分析 #### 2.2.1 CPU和内存性能 CPU和内存是系统性能的关键因素。在基准测试中,通常关注以下性能指标: - CPU的时钟频率、核心数和指令集。 - 内存的容量、带宽和延迟。 这些指标决定了系统处理任务的能力和速度。例如,较高的CPU时钟频率通常意味着更快的处理速度,而较低的内存延迟则意味着更快的数据访问速度。 #### 2.2.2 I/O吞吐量和延迟 I/O吞吐量和延迟对于存储密集型应用尤其重要。吞吐量是指单位时间内可以读写的数据量,而延迟是指完成单个I/O操作所需的时间。测试工具如fio可以帮助我们评估存储系统的性能: ```bash fio --name=write_test --directory=/path/to/directory --size=1G --rw=write --iodepth=1 --numjobs=1 --bs=1M --runtime=60 --group_reporting ``` 上述命令将测试单线程下的写入操作性能,输出结果可以帮助我们了解I/O性能。 #### 2.2.3 网络性能指标 网络性能指标,如带宽、延迟、吞吐量和丢包率,是衡量网络设备和配置的重要参数。网络基准测试工具有iperf3: ```bash # 在服务器端运行iperf3 iperf3 -s # 在客户端运行iperf3,连接到服务器 iperf3 -c <server_ip> ``` 执行测试后,iperf3会输出详细的网络性能数据,包括带宽和延迟等。 ### 2.3 基准测试的工作流程 #### 2.3.1 测试前的准备与配置 在开始基准测试之前,需要确保测试环境是干净且稳定的。这包括: - 更新操作系统和所有相关软件到最新版本。 - 关闭不必要的服务和应用程序。 - 配置网络和存储设备,确保它们处于最佳状态。 #### 2.3.2 实际测试过程与监控 在测试过程中,应监控系统的运行情况,确保测试环境的一致性,并记录所有相关的性能数据。这可以通过日志文件、系统监控工具或测试软件自身提供的监控功能来完成。 #### 2.3.3 结果的收集与分析 测试完成后,收集数据并进行深入分析至关重要。比较结果与预期目标和行业标准,找出性能瓶颈,并制定改进计划。 基准测试是性能评估的一个复杂但重要的过程。通过理解基准测试的定义、目的、性能指标以及工作流程,可以更加有效地进行系统的性能评估和优化。在后续章节中,我们将看到这些理论如何应用到JMS567固件的实际测试中。 # 3. JMS567固件的基准测试实践 ## 3.1 JMS567固件的测试环境搭建 在开始基准测试之前,构建一个稳定且可控的测试环境是非常关键的步骤。环境的搭建包括硬件和软件两个方面,接下来将详细讨论这两个方面的配置与优化。 ### 3.1.1 硬件环境配置 JMS567固件基准测试的硬件环境搭建要求如下: - 至少需要一个支持的硬件平台进行测试,如服务器或特定的开发板。 - 为确保测试数据的一致性,建
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

医疗行业数据处理新选择:Coze工作流精确性提升案例

![医疗行业数据处理新选择:Coze工作流精确性提升案例](https://krispcall.com/blog/wp-content/uploads/2024/04/Workflow-automation.webp) # 1. 医疗数据处理与工作流概论 ## 1.1 医疗数据处理的重要性 医疗数据的处理是医疗行业信息化进程中的核心环节。数据准确性和时效性的提升,直接关系到医疗服务质量、科研效率和临床决策的科学性。从电子病历的管理到临床路径的分析,再到疾病预测模型的建立,医疗数据处理为医疗机构提供了前所未有的支持,成为推动医疗行业进步的关键力量。 ## 1.2 工作流在医疗数据处理中的作

视图模型与数据绑定:异步任务管理的艺术平衡

![视图模型与数据绑定:异步任务管理的艺术平衡](https://img-blog.csdnimg.cn/acb122de6fc745f68ce8d596ed640a4e.png) # 1. 视图模型与数据绑定基础 在现代软件开发中,视图模型(ViewModel)与数据绑定(Data Binding)是创建动态且响应式用户界面(UI)的核心概念。视图模型是一种设计模式,它将视图逻辑与业务逻辑分离,为UI层提供了更为清晰和可维护的代码结构。数据绑定则是一种技术,允许开发者将UI控件与后端数据源进行连接,从而实现UI的自动化更新。 在这一章节中,我们将探讨视图模型和数据绑定的基础知识,并分析它

ASP定时任务实现攻略:构建自动化任务处理系统,效率倍增!

![ASP定时任务实现攻略:构建自动化任务处理系统,效率倍增!](https://www.anoopcnair.com/wp-content/uploads/2023/02/Intune-Driver-Firmware-Update-Policies-Fig-2-1024x516.webp) # 摘要 ASP定时任务是实现自动化和提高工作效率的重要工具,尤其在业务流程、数据管理和自动化测试等场景中发挥着关键作用。本文首先概述了ASP定时任务的基本概念和重要性,接着深入探讨了ASP环境下定时任务的理论基础和实现原理,包括任务调度的定义、工作机制、触发机制以及兼容性问题。通过实践技巧章节,本文分

Hartley算法升级版:机器学习结合信号处理的未来趋势

![Hartley算法升级版:机器学习结合信号处理的未来趋势](https://roboticsbiz.com/wp-content/uploads/2022/09/Support-Vector-Machine-SVM.jpg) # 摘要 本文深入探讨了Hartley算法在信号处理中的理论基础及其与机器学习技术的融合应用。第一章回顾了Hartley算法的基本原理,第二章详细讨论了机器学习与信号处理的结合,特别是在特征提取、分类算法和深度学习网络结构方面的应用。第三章分析了Hartley算法的升级版以及其在软件实现中的效率提升策略。第四章展示了Hartley算法与机器学习结合的多个案例,包括语

Coze项目社区互动:提升用户体验与参与度的关键策略

![Coze项目社区互动:提升用户体验与参与度的关键策略](https://antavo.com/wp-content/uploads/2021/08/image17.png) # 1. Coze项目社区互动的概述 ## 1.1 社区互动的重要性 在数字化时代的背景下,社区互动已成为构建活跃用户群体和提供卓越用户体验的关键因素。Coze项目社区互动的设计、实现和管理不仅能够增加用户粘性,还能提升品牌价值和市场竞争力。 ## 1.2 社区互动的目标与功能 社区互动的主要目标是为用户提供一个自由交流的空间,让他们能够分享想法、解决问题、参与讨论和反馈。Coze项目通过整合论坛、投票、讨论区等功

【爬虫扩展功能开发】:集成人工智能进行内容分类和识别新境界

![【爬虫扩展功能开发】:集成人工智能进行内容分类和识别新境界](http://training.parthenos-project.eu/wp-content/uploads/2018/11/Figure-11.png) # 摘要 随着互联网信息量的爆炸性增长,爬虫技术在数据采集和处理方面扮演着越来越重要的角色。本文首先概述了爬虫的扩展功能开发,然后深入探讨了人工智能技术,包括机器学习与深度学习,以及其在爬虫中的应用理论和实践。通过分析内容分类、图像识别和语音识别等AI技术的实现,本文揭示了如何将这些技术集成到爬虫系统中,并讨论了系统集成、性能优化和安全隐私保护的策略。最后,本文对爬虫技术

持久层优化

![持久层优化](https://nilebits.com/wp-content/uploads/2024/01/CRUD-in-SQL-Unleashing-the-Power-of-Seamless-Data-Manipulation-1140x445.png) # 摘要 持久层优化在提升数据存储和访问性能方面扮演着关键角色。本文详细探讨了持久层优化的概念、基础架构及其在实践中的应用。首先介绍了持久层的定义、作用以及常用的持久化技术。接着阐述了性能优化的理论基础,包括目标、方法和指标,同时深入分析了数据库查询与结构优化理论。在实践应用部分,本文探讨了缓存策略、批处理、事务以及数据库连接池

【CI_CD集成】:PEM到P12转换,自动化部署的最佳实践

![【CI_CD集成】:PEM到P12转换,自动化部署的最佳实践](https://www.edureka.co/blog/content/ver.1531719070/uploads/2018/07/CI-CD-Pipeline-Hands-on-CI-CD-Pipeline-edureka-5.png) # 摘要 随着软件开发速度的加快,CI/CD集成与自动化部署的重要性日益凸显,它能显著提高软件交付效率和质量。本文首先概述了CI/CD集成与自动化部署的基本概念,接着深入分析了PEM和P12两种常用文件格式的结构与加密原理,以及从PEM到P12的转换过程中所面临的技术挑战。第三章专注于自

五子棋FPGA并行处理:技巧与实例的全面解读

![wuziqi.rar_xilinx五子棋](https://static.fuxi.netease.com/fuxi-official/web/20221010/eae499807598c85ea2ae310b200ff283.jpg) # 摘要 本文探讨了五子棋游戏规则、策略及其在FPGA并行处理架构中的实现。首先,概述了五子棋的基础规则和胜负判定标准,并分析了策略和算法优化的必要性。随后,本文详细介绍了FPGA的设计原理、硬件描述语言(VHDL和Verilog HDL)的编程技巧,以及开发工具与调试过程。接着,文章通过实例分析了五子棋FPGA并行处理的设计和实现,重点讨论了并行算法的

UMODEL Win32版本控制实践:源代码管理的黄金标准

![umodel_win32.zip](https://mmbiz.qpic.cn/mmbiz_jpg/E0P3ucicTSFTRCwvkichkJF4QwzdhEmFOrvaOw0O0D3wRo2BE1yXIUib0FFUXjLLWGbo25B48aLPrjKVnfxv007lg/640?wx_fmt=jpeg) # 摘要 UMODEL Win32版本控制系统的深入介绍与使用,涉及其基础概念、配置、初始化、基本使用方法、高级功能以及未来发展趋势。文章首先介绍UMODEL Win32的基础知识,包括系统配置和初始化过程。接着,详细阐述了其基本使用方法,涵盖源代码控制、变更集管理和遵循版本控制